Choleric-Phlegmatic. Contains Blue (Phlegmatic) and Red (Choleric) colors. The Choleric-Phlegmatic (or "Director") is a balanced, goal-oriented leader who combines the drive and decisiveness of a Choleric with the calm, steady nature of a Phlegmatic. They are "firm but fair," patient in achieving goals, and highly efficient, yet they can be stubborn and may avoid open conflict, relying on sarcasm or calm persistence instead. 
Choleric. Contains Red colors with spiky triangle forms. Goal-oriented, dominant, and highly energetic. May be perceived as too aggressive or bossy
Sanguine. Contains Yellow and Orange colors with soft round forms. a personality temperament characterized by an optimistic, cheerful, confident, and outgoing dispositionю . Often described as "people-oriented extroverts," individuals with this temperament thrive on social interaction and are frequently viewed as the "life of the party"
Phlegmatic. Contains Blue colors and stable square forms. Calm, easygoing, and, above all, conflict-avoidant. The personality that is emotionally stable, consistent, and slow to anger.
Melancholic. Contains Grey and Black colors and tiny forms. Introverted, deeply emotional, and analytical temperament defined by high sensitivity, perfectionism, and a methodical approach to life.
Sanguine-Melancholic. Contains Grey-Black (Melancholic) and Yellow (Sanguine) colors. a highly creative, talkative, and detail-oriented "performer" who blends intense social desire with a need for accuracy. They are sociable yet introspective, often acting as diplomatic, organized, and sensitive individuals who can, however, experience mood swings and internal conflicts between needing people and needing solitude​​​​​​​
